Overview
The MST-250XS holds 1.5 quarts, enough for one solid serving of soup or stew, a full batch of queso dip, or a small dessert like lava cake. It weighs 4.8 lb and measures 7.5 by 10 by 7 inches, a genuinely compact package that tucks into a cabinet without trouble. The plastic body with a stainless steel color gives it a cleaner appearance than some all-white budget competitors.
No wattage is listed, but the 120-volt standard plug and touch controls confirm standard home use. At $15.99 it is among the least expensive slow cookers available anywhere, and the price makes it easy to recommend for single-person households or as a party accessory.

Performance notes
No wattage data is available for the MST-250XS, but it operates on a standard 120-volt circuit. For a 1.5-quart cooker with touch controls, expect basic low and high heat settings. The small volume means heat-up is fast relative to larger models. The plastic body stays cooler on the outside than metal-bodied cookers, which is a practical safety benefit.

Can I use the MST-250XS to keep food warm at a party?
Yes, keeping dips, queso, meatballs, or small sauces warm is one of the most common uses for a 1.5-quart slow cooker like this one. Set it to low or the warm setting and it will hold the temperature without scorching. Just be sure to stir periodically and check the food, especially for dairy-based dips.
Is the insert safe to wash in the dishwasher?
The listing data does not confirm dishwasher compatibility for the insert. Many small slow cooker inserts at this price tier are hand-wash only. Check the product manual or current listing details on Amazon to confirm before putting it in the dishwasher.
